We had our frozen embyro transfer 8 days ago and ovidrel 15 days ago. I had a very faint positive this morning. Blood test is Tues. Our last round failed so I'm not feeling very hopeful. Anyone have any insight?

Do you now what the strength of the ovidrel was this is what I found

To ensure accuracy of your HPT following an hCG trigger shot, keep in mind the following guidelines: wait at least 14 days after a 10,000 IU injection, 10 days after a 5,000 IU injection, or 7 days after a 2,500 IU injection.

How this helps xx
